**Evelyn Waugh: A Life Revisited** serves up the deliciously scandalous truth about Britain's most wickedly funny novelist. Philip Eade peels back the layers of Waugh's complex personality, revealing the man behind satirical gems like *Decline and Fall* and *Vile Bodies*. This biography doesn't shy away from Waugh's notorious snobbery, his brutal wit, or his complicated relationships with friends, family, and society.
Perfect for literature lovers, comedy enthusiasts, and anyone fascinated by the eccentric characters of 20th-century British writing. Eade masterfully balances scholarly insight with entertaining storytelling, making this accessible to both Waugh devotees and curious newcomers exploring literary biography.
